Frequently Asked Questions About Insurance in Cuney

What type of homeowners insurance coverage is most important for properties in Cuney, Texas, given the local climate?

In Cuney, Texas, which experiences hot, humid summers and is part of a region prone to severe thunderstorms, hail, and occasional tornadoes, wind and hail coverage is critically important. Standard Texas homeowners policies often include windstorm coverage, but it's essential to review your policy for specific deductibles and exclusions, especially for hail damage to roofs. Given the area's high humidity, ensuring adequate coverage for mold or water damage resulting from storms is also advisable.

How does living in a small, rural community like Cuney, Texas, affect auto insurance rates compared to larger cities in the state?

Residents of small, rural towns like Cuney typically benefit from lower auto insurance premiums compared to drivers in densely populated urban areas such as Houston or Dallas. This is primarily due to significantly less traffic congestion, lower rates of accidents, and a reduced risk of vehicle theft. However, factors like your driving record, the age and type of your vehicle, and the specific coverage limits you choose will still be the primary determinants of your final rate.

Are there specific insurance considerations for landowners or farmers with acreage in the Cuney area?

Yes, landowners in the Cuney area should consider a farm and ranch insurance policy or a comprehensive landowners liability policy. These policies provide crucial liability coverage for injuries to hunters, trespassers, or guests on your property, which is important given the rural setting. They can also offer protection for outbuildings, equipment, and livestock, which are typically not covered under a standard homeowners policy.

What should renters in Cuney, Texas, know about renters insurance, especially regarding common local risks?

Renters in Cuney should secure a policy that covers their personal property against perils common to East Texas, including theft, fire, and storm-related water damage. It's also vital that the policy includes sufficient liability coverage, which protects you if someone is injured in your rental home. Given the prevalence of severe weather, ensure your policy explicitly covers wind and hail damage to your belongings, as some basic policies may have limitations.

How can local business owners in Cuney ensure they have adequate commercial insurance for a small-town operation?

Small business owners in Cuney should start with a Business Owners Policy (BOP), which bundles general liability and property insurance, crucial for protecting against customer injuries and damage to your business premises from local weather events. It's also wise to consider commercial auto insurance if you use a vehicle for business purposes and to evaluate the need for business interruption coverage, which can help replace lost income if a severe storm forces you to temporarily close.

Finding the Best Whole Life Insurance Companies for Cuney, Texas Residents

For residents of Cuney, Texas, securing financial stability for your family often means looking beyond the immediate horizon. In this close-knit Cherokee County community, where many families have deep roots and value long-term planning, whole life insurance stands out as a cornerstone of a solid financial strategy. Unlike term insurance, whole life provides lifelong coverage with a cash value component that grows over time, offering both a death benefit and a living asset. For Cuney locals, this can be particularly appealing as it aligns with the values of legacy building and enduring protection that resonate in our small-town setting. When searching for the best whole life insurance companies, it's crucial to consider providers that understand the unique dynamics of East Texas, including our local economy and the importance of personalized service. Texas has specific insurance regulations, and companies operating here must be licensed by the Texas Department of Insurance, ensuring they meet state standards for financial stability and consumer protection. This is a key factor to verify when evaluating insurers, as you want a company that will be there for decades to come, much like the enduring spirit of Cuney itself. Local independent insurance agents in the Tyler or Jacksonville areas, which serve Cuney, can be invaluable resources. They often represent multiple carriers, allowing them to compare policies from the best whole life insurance companies and find one that fits your budget and needs. Given Cuney's rural character, factors like health history, age, and desired coverage amount will influence your premiums, but a good agent can help navigate these variables. It's also wise to look for companies with strong financial ratings from agencies like A.M. Best, indicating their ability to pay claims far into the future. For many in Cuney, whole life insurance isn't just a policy; it's a tool for creating generational wealth, funding final expenses, or even supplementing retirement income from local industries like agriculture or manufacturing. When reviewing the best whole life insurance companies, ask about dividend-paying policies from mutual companies, as these can potentially increase your cash value over time. Remember, the best choice is one that offers reliable coverage, competitive costs, and excellent customer service tailored to your life in Cuney. Start by getting quotes from a few highly-rated insurers, and don't hesitate to ask detailed questions about policy features, fees, and loan options against the cash value. By taking these steps, you can secure a policy that provides peace of mind and financial security for your loved ones, right here in our Texas community.
